What Deer Valley HOA's governing documents say
Deer Valley is a rural subdivision with covenants designed for small farmsteads, cabin retreats, and peaceful living. These rules apply to all parcel owners and are not a standard HOA — restrictions are minimal, emphasizing privacy and land stewardship.
- Allowed use & commercial activity: All parcels are for single-family residential and recreational use only. No commercial activity, marijuana growing, or greenhouses (hobby farming allowed).
- Dwellings & temporary structures: Only one permanent single-family dwelling per 5 acres. Temporary structures like tents or trailers may be used for recreation but cannot stay more than 21 days per calendar year.
- Livestock & pets: You may keep livestock or pets as long as they don't create a nuisance. No commercial swine operations. No more than 3 dogs per property, and dogs must be confined to your parcel.
- Environmental protections & waste: Trash must be in closed containers; no dumping or burying waste. Derelict vehicles must be in an enclosed garage. Trees over 6 inches in diameter may be cut only if dead/dying or for specific purposes, and no more than 20% of a parcel may be cleared. No commercial timber harvest or rock removal.
- Hunting: Hunting is allowed on the property, but not from or on the access roads. Follow state license and season requirements.
- Road maintenance & setbacks: Each owner is responsible for maintaining their private access road. Commercial vehicles using the road must repair any damage. Structures must be set back 70 feet from the edge of any access road and 50 feet from property boundaries.
- Subdivision restrictions: Parcels may not be subdivided without the seller's written consent.
- What this document doesn't cover: This is not a full HOA rulebook; it does not address architectural review, community amenities, or association governance. These are covenants recorded against the land, and the seller retains some approval rights.
